Rahma Isihaka Kimbe
I live with my father and I have two young sisters who both live with my mother. I love studying and achieving my goals. The most difficult experiences in my life are the many times I was chased from school for not paying my fees. Although I felt bad, I still convinced myself that I had to struggle in my studies so my children don't experience the same.

The moment I felt very proud of myself was when I got the result for my last primary exams. I got grade A. I was very happy and proud since it was always my dream to pass the exams. I want to become a surgeon and I know I need high grades in my science subjects in order to achieve that.

Here are the lesson that we can possibly obtain from the some I sent to you guys.

1. Imagine a world without borders or divisions:
This lesson encourages us to envision a world where geographical boundaries, nationalities, races, and cultures do not separate people. It emphasizes the importance of unity and solidarity among all individuals, regardless of their backgrounds or differences.

2. Consider the possibility of a world without material possessions:
Lennon suggests the idea of a world where possessions and wealth are not prioritized, implying a society where materialism and consumerism are replaced by values such as compassion, empathy, and generosity. This lesson challenges us to reassess our attachment to material goods and recognize the importance of focusing on intangible aspects of life.

3. Embrace the concept of living in the present moment:
By urging us to let go of past grievances and future anxieties, this lesson advocates for mindfulness and living fully in the present. It encourages us to appreciate the beauty and significance of each moment, fostering gratitude and contentment in our lives.

4. Envision a world without the need for religion or political ideologies:
Lennon proposes a world where divisive beliefs and ideologies are set aside in favor of mutual respect, tolerance, and understanding. This lesson emphasizes the importance of transcending religious and political differences to foster unity and peace among individuals and communities.

5. Recognize the power of collective imagination:
By highlighting the potential of collective imagination to shape a better future, this lesson underscores the importance of shared visions and aspirations. It encourages collaboration and cooperation among individuals to bring about positive societal change, demonstrating that by collectively imagining a better world, we can work towards making it a reality.
